## Narrative
I was driving home with my 3 kids in the car. Age 13,10,2 We were almost home and my daughter shouted from the back seatâ¦ â thereâs a fire .. thereâs a fireâ my self and my 13 year old son proceeded to look outside the car for a fire. We both kept saying where? My daughter then said â right there look upâ we both looked and the passenger side visor was in flames where it connects to the roof of the jeep. My son tried to blow it out but it sparked up 2 more times before he held the visor up before the fire went out completely. This was absolutely terrifying. Iâm so worried my car is going to catch on fire while I am sleeping tonight. Please help
